区块链-

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

BlockChain两个基本问题–类两军问题拜占庭将军问题:拜占庭帝国派10支军队进攻一敌人,这个敌人可以抵御5支军队同时袭击,这10支军队不能集合单点突破,必须分开同时攻击。问题是多个将军互相并不信任(存在叛徒)时,这种状态下要保证进攻一致,需要某种分布式协议来进行远程协调。如果每个将军向其他九位将军派出一名信使,总计90次传输,部分叛徒还会故意答应一个的攻击时间,所以他们将重新广播超过一条的信息链。这个系统变成不可靠和攻击时间矛盾的混合体。两个基本问题–拜占庭将军问题解决思路拜占庭将军的故事最后,数学家们设计了一套算法,让将军们在接到上一位将军的信息之后,加上自己的签名再转给除自己以外的其他将军,这样的信息模块就形成了区块链。在一个40人以上的微信群里组局聚餐,如何统计人数?一种方式是大家纷纷发言,有人来统计;另一种方式是让大家来接龙,每个人在上一个人的后面累加一个号并加上自己的名字,最后就能记录全部的报名人员和人数——区块链。举个例子微信组局在区块链里的概念接龙发帖链式数据结构(1)规则:每个人发帖=上一个贴内容+下一个编号+自己名字共识机制,根据严格的规则和公开的协议形成规则定下来后,大家自发登记去中心化,没有任何单一用户能控制它在微信群里记录登记情况点对点对等网络只要联网就能知道最新进展博弈机制(2)为了形成40个人的报名记录,至少有40人发40篇帖子才够,群友手机里都存档分布式(多点备份)、高冗余每篇帖子大家都看得见,更新的记录是否数字错了、人重复了、每个人都可以检查共享账簿群里的人大都认识,各有各的名字/代号通过非对称计算加密技术验证陌生人目录01区块链技术基本原理02区块链主要应用领域区块链的基本原理01比特币是一种利用加密技术来实现独立于中央银行之外,协议地发行和验证支付有效性的电子货币和在线支付系统。货币的支付不通过中心机构,支付记录会向全网节点发送并记录,通过全网节点的计算验证其有效性,货币的发行是对各节点运算工作的奖励,通过这种方式为用户提供计算机算力来核对保障比特币支付,随着比特币总量的增加,新币制造的速度减慢,直到2140年达到2100万个的总量上限。去中心化的借贷模型问题1-----凭啥找对象问题二---听谁的问题三---双花问题最早的比特币产生价格是在2010年,美国一程序员用一万枚比特币换了两张价值25美元的披萨券,这是比特币第一次有了价格。区块链?Blockchain是区块链是一串使用密码学方法相关联产生的数据块,每一个数据块中包含了一次网络交易的信息,用于验证其信息的有效性(防伪)和生成下一个区块。概念首次出现:《比特币:一种点对点的电子现金系统》》,区块链诞生自中本聪的比特币。2、区块链的定义和来源3、背景互联网上的贸易,几乎都需要借助可信赖的第三方信用机构来处理电子支付信息。这类系统仍然内生性地受制于“基于信用的模式”。区块链技术是构建比特币区块链网络与交易信息加密传输的基础技术。它基于密码学原理不基于信用,使得任何达成一致的双方直接支付,从而不需要第三方中介的参与。6、区块链的关键概念分布式记帐交易记账由分布在不同地方的多个节点共同完成,而且每一个节点都记录的是完整的账目,因此它们都可以参与监督交易合法性,同时也可以共同为其作证。不同于传统的中心化记账方案,没有任何一个节点可以单独记录账目,从而避免了单一记账人被控制或者被贿赂而记假账的可能性。所有记账节点之间怎么达成共识,去认定一个记录的有效性,这既是认定的手段,也是防止篡改的手段。区块链提出了四种不同的共识机制,适用于不同的应用场景,在效率和安全性之间取得平衡。以比特币为例,采用的是工作量证明,只有在控制了全网超过51%的记账节点的情况下,才有可能伪造出一条不存在的记录。当加入区块链的节点足够多的时候,这基本上不可能,从而杜绝了造假的可能。共识机制智能合约是基于这些可信的不可篡改的数据,可以自动化的执行一些预先定义好的规则和条款。IF...then...以保险为例,如果说每个人的信息(包括医疗信息和风险发生的信息)都是真实可信的,那就很容易的在一些标准化的保险产品中,去进行自动化的理赔。投保人风险管理在现在的保险经营中,保险公司和投保人的纠纷时有发生,要么是投保人提供虚假的个人信息骗保,要么是理赔的时候对于免责条款的认定发生分歧。而这些问题的关键都在于对投保人的个人信息缺乏一个真实可信的数据采集和存储手段。智慧合约密码体系存储在区块链上的交易信息是公开的,但是账户身份信息是高度加密的,只有在数据拥有者授权的情况下才能访问到,从而保证了数据的安全和个人的隐私。7、区块链的核心技术去中心化网络中没有中心化的物理节点和管理机构,网络功能的维护依赖网络中所有具有维护能力的节点完成,各节点的地位是平等的,一个节点甚至几个节点的损坏不会影响整个系统的运作,网络具备很强的健壮性。去信任网络节点间数据传输是匿名的而且节点之间不需要互相信任,整个系统通过公开透明数学算法运行。节点彼此数据公开,彼此信任,没有办法欺骗其他节点。数据库可靠系统中每个节点都能获得一份完整的“账本”(数据库)的拷贝,除非能够同时控制整个系统中超过51%的节点,否则单个节点上对数据的修改是无效的,也无法影响其他节点上的数据内容。8、区块链的网络构架公共区块链网络中的节点可以任意接入,网络中的读写权限不受限制,任何人都能参与共识过程,比特币属于典型的公有链。私有区块链网络中的节点被一个组织控制,写入权限仅限在一个组织内部,读取权限有限对外开放,全球42家银行组建的区块链联盟R3CEV就是私有链。联盟区块链网络中部分节点可以任意接入,另一部分则必须通过权限才可以接入的区块链,比如清算。区块链V.S.互联网区块链基于互联网运行,但其功能却广于互联网。两种技术的相同点主要在于:在数据传输方式上,互联网与区块链都不需要中心化的中介;两种技术都要求用户接入互联网;两种技术都能够满足一个组织内的多个使用者同时使用。两者的差异点主要在于:互联网技术的主要用途是实现信息的快速发送和接收,而区块链的主要用途则是实现数据的储存和记录;区块链上的数据具有高度防篡改性,而互联网数据只有在实现加密等保护性措施的前提下,才具有防篡改的性能。区块链主要应用领域02陌生人之间如何实现相互信任?小赵还想买辆二手车,但是卖家会有动机虚报自己的里程数,甚至谎称自己的车子没有经历过事故和维修,小赵该如何判断呢?该怎么证明我妈是我妈?如何实现自证?北京市民陈先生一家三口准备出境旅游,需要明确一位亲人为紧急联络人,于是他想到了自己的母亲。可问题来了,需要书面证明他和他母亲是母子关系。可陈先生在北京的户口簿,只显示自己和老婆孩子的信息,而父母在江西老家的户口簿,早就没有了陈先生的信息。已发生的交易记录如何不被篡改?艾女士居住在洪都拉斯,她住在自家房子很多年,某天,艾女士遭到法院传讯。C向法院申请驱逐艾女士,原来国家产权局登记的是C的名字,而后房屋被拆毁。但后来经过法院查证,房子其实就是人家艾女士的,但不动产已经毁了,艾女士只能默默流泪……银行存款凭空消失,能找回吗?谁来负责?2015年,我国多地频频出现银行储户存款“失踪”案件:浙江杭州42位银行储户发现,自己的数百万元存款仅剩少许甚至被“清零”;泸州老窖等知名企业存款也出现“异常”,甚至还出现3个月内农业银行、工商银行的5亿元不知去向。1、区块链引发的农业变革或将来临国内物联网的数据其实是很分散的,有的分散在信息公司,有的分散在农业部,有一些在科研院所,有一些在农业企业那里,所以很杂很乱,数据也不能交互,也不能连接,连接程度很低。现在很多企业、合作社每天要填各种表格,提交各种证明,区块链能直接采集这些数据,不管从政府监管角度,还是从金融、社会服务角度,还是从企业、社会合作本身,都是很有意义的。通过互联网及互联网身份标识技术,将生产商生产出来的每件产品信息全部记录到区块链中,就可以在区块链中形成每一件商品的真实生命轨迹。消费者通过自己的智能终端,可实时跟踪每件商品的动态,从而保证消费流程全透明。完成商品溯源工作。现代农业、区块链在农业领域内的应用,一个又一个崭新、统一的标准陆续规范、出台,我们正处于农业新的大变革的前夜,我们将迎来、见证农业新的大变革时代。拥有身份证的赣南脐橙区块链技术放在赣南脐橙的防伪应用上,就相当于把橙子的源头(即产地果园)、采摘、收储、加工、销售的每一个环节的信息都记录到“区块”,它们被添加到“链”上,参与者(即消费者、商家、果农)可以从这条“链”上看到清晰透明的记录,从而确认橙子的真实身份。“链橙”就是利用区块链智慧防伪,数据存真的特点,为赣南脐橙贴上独特的防伪标签。每一颗“链橙”都有自己专属的“身份证”,实现赣南脐橙从田间到餐桌上的每一个环节都即时可追溯。无论是消费者、商家、还是果农,都可以通过扫码确认“链橙”流通中的每一个细节,进而确定赣南脐橙的真实性。大北农猪联网猪联网重点解决了生猪管理效率提升、饲养管理规范化、生猪可追溯性和安全性的问题,这一点对食品企业来说是很有帮助的,我们理解大型屠宰食品企业遇到的问题之一是如何保障充足、稳定且健康的猪源,目前猪联网不断积累的大量生猪可以很快帮他们迅速找到猪,并可以查看相应猪群的历史饲养记录、健康情况等各项数据。同时猪联网提供的互联网金融服务也是他们所急需的。京东走步鸡京东走步鸡一定是放养的,并且借助科技手段,给每只鸡都带上了脚环计步器,实时记录步数。当记录的步数超过一百万步时,京东就会以当地价格的三倍进行回购,然后用最科学安全的方法进行屠宰,在京东上销售。区块链助推农村普惠金融发展农业是一个平常又特殊的行业,各种不确定的风险因素叠加,通过银行风险测评拿到理想的贷款有实际的困难。而区块链的出现,则有助于破解这一难题。土地证明、身份证、营业执照这些是必须要提供的,但这仅仅是最基础的,银行的风险评定还需要很多方面的考虑,比如你所种植的土地上是否全部种植了农作物,价值是多少;是否有种植经验,种植经验多少;品种是否有优势性;周边的自然灾害多不多,个人的信用怎么样等等。2、区块链对企业的影响随着区块链的日益成熟,越来越多的企业开始期盼能够利用该技术进行革新。的确,如同上世纪90年代末互联网对于通信的变革一样,区块链有望为众多领域带来一次前所未有的改变——仅在供应链和物流行业,该技术每年就有望帮助企业节省数十亿美元的成本,并显著减少延误和损坏情况的出现。3、区块链+医疗各个医院、诊所等医疗平台之间,很难安全地进行跨平台共享数据。而如果各平台数据能够有效并安全地共享,这将大大提高确诊概率、缩短问诊时间,进而提高整个医疗系统的运作效率。4、区块链+供应链管理如果能将区块链技术应用在供应链管理中,那么物品从生产到销售之间的任何一个运输交易节点都能够被永久记录,可以大大减少物品运输延期、运输成本增加以及人为错误的可能性。许多初创公司都瞄准了区块链技术在供应链管理领域的应用。比如,Provenance公司正在打造一个可追溯材料产品运输流程的系统,Skuchain则提供了一个面向B2B贸易和供应链融资市场的区块链系统。5、区块链+政府政务链是政务服务区块链平台,可将大多数类型的政府部门机构、事业单位、社会活动等的业务转移到区块链中,所有业务由智能法律和智能合约驱动。具有四个基本功能:金融系统、登记注册机构、智能合约算法,以及智能法律框架和执行机制。金融系统可使用锚定法币的代币进行转账交易,智能合约可自动执行注册管理机构涉及对象和法币交易,智能法律规范了智能合约的创建、实施和运行,并自动规范了政务服务内个人和部门机构的关系。5、区块链在金融领域的应用5纳斯达克与Chain.com合作,上线用于私有股权交易的linq平台,2015年12月30日第一笔股票发行Ripple为金融机构提供跨境支付和外汇市场做市的区域联解决方案澳大利亚证券交易所ASX打算用区块链解决方案替代CSD中央证券存管机构。ASX在2017年中之前就要做出是否首创区块链概念证明机制的决定。OverstockMediciPro

1 / 50
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功